    Believe it or not, I've actually had really good luck getting smaller spaghetti sauce splatters on clothes out with Woolite Oxy Deep Spot Remover for carpet. A paste made of the Oxyclean product for laundry mixed with a little water and applied to the spot(s) might work too. If the piece of clothing is white, trying a little bleach couldn't hurt either.

    I use 2 methods: In Summer I launder the article and hang it outside in the sunshine to dry. The sun will remove the stain...In Winter, I launder the article and hang it outside overnight when there is a frost. The frost will also remove the stain. (Great for table cloths).
